Airy and spacious, this is a large alcove studio in the architecturally distinguished Chatham Towers. The unit offers city views through its two double paned 7 picture windows. With approximately 550 sq. ft. and a flexible layout, it can easily be reimagined into a comfortable home. Parking is $235/m for shareholders.
